I don't really think we're in a hurry to upgrade to the latest MyPaint (which is at version 1.0.0 or so) because the current one, as far as my experience goes, is doing fine even till now. But I'm not against the effort to make an upgrade to the existing one available, so taking it slowly is fine too.
Though, I'm quite perplexed that since N9s have capacitive screens, MyPaint more or less won't work on it... which is too bad since I kind of want the phone with this on it.
Some of the new features added in MyPaint 1.0.0 is the re-worked UI making it dockable (although for the time being they only dock to the right of the screen), and some other generic changes in the brush palettes and a new feature called the Scratchpad, which is convenient for users to try out various coloring and brush stroke combinations etc without having to jot them on the main drawing canvas.
As far as the rendering quality/performance ratio goes I haven't been able to notice significant increase nor decrease either, at least from what I think of it. Other users who experienced both MyPaint 1.0.0 on the desktop and 0.9.1 on the N900 might have better input than me... or so I hope.

You are doing it too hard way. There are no need for downloading anything by hands. Installing mypaint and upgrading existing packages is enough.
On Maemo5 we have python-gtk2 -2.12.1-6maemo10 which is enough to run Mypaint. Check do you have that version.
(e.g. apt-cache policy python-gtk2)
And then post exact error message. It contains row numbers and they can give hints what is happening.
